Hi Laurence,

Nice experiment. A few OMs tried a full size dipole for MF now, me too. TX wise it is not as bad as expected by some theoretical focused OMs, despite the little height above ground. For /p, it is a real alternative, better than a 10m vertical i think. But there are better systems, as you say.
Good luck in KH6. This may be interesting for the VK / ZL OMs!!

WE2XPQ Palmer Alaska is on CW info  loop 475kHz thru today for continued ground wave profiling - will be on WSPR2 tonight. 200W TPO - and a few Watts ERP.  Mix Pol.
 
We tested a full size squashed (over 5 acres) resonant dipole at 30ft for 475kHz (some 500ft each leg)  last night but it didnt manage to get a signal out of State - Z was 100ohms given its 'folded state' but was matched at feedpoint ok - I dont intend to keep this up as its Dx performance on rx was "ok" but typically (but not all the times) worse than the K9AY and L400bs. It took me nearly 4 days total time to errect as I was interested to at least try it out against the calcs and books -  Ill probably use of the the legs and readjest heights into some form of long wire/beverage.
 
Conditions are still pretty dire with no station >3000Kms decoded last night. Hope the Coronal holes, CME, elevated College K, Protons all go on holiday soon. Nothing coming over the North or South poles at the moment.
